Customer Support Supervisor

Customer Support Supervisor
Company:

New Zealand Government Jobs


Details of the offer

Job Description

What you will do

In this role you will provide support to the team and management of the Service Delivery Centre. The role is responsible for ensuring customer service solutions are delivered, measured and reported and all opportunities are acted on to achieve the highest standard of shared service delivery.

What we need

We are seeking a person with experience of delivering a high level of customer service. You have excellent administrative knowledge which covers a range of support functions and you are a great on the job trainer. Prior experience of supervising a team is essential.
Being an exceptional communicator with strong interpersonal skills you can build and maintain strong working relationship across a diverse range of people. As a seasoned administrator you have strong computer skills, in particular you are fully conversant with the Microsoft Office Suite, any exposure to SAP is a definite advantage.

Who we are

The Service Centre is the “front office” of the Defence Shared Services and acts to give personal service to NZDF customers, provides accessible and timely responses to requests for service and acts as a conduit to the Defence Shared Services National Service Centre and is the key point-of-contact between these groups and operational commanders, output owners and business owners to ensure effective delivery of Base support unit functions to operational commanders and other users. This may at times include 24/7 delivery considerations.

Every hour of every day, 365 days of the year, the New Zealand Defence Force is contributing to the defence, security and well-being of Aotearoa / New Zealand. As a modern, professional military, it is our goal to maintain well trained, equipped and disciplined armed forces that can react to crisis at short notice.

Please note:Applicants must be legally entitled to work in New Zealand (NZ) and be able to obtain and maintain the required level of NZ Government security clearance for the position applied for. The minimum citizenship and residency criteria for security clearances to be granted by the NZ Defence Force are as follows:

Low level Security Clearance
most preferably a NZ citizen, whohas resided in this country continuouslyfor at least the lastfive years, OR
is a citizen of,and/or has resided continuouslyin one or more of the following countries for the lastfive years: either Australia, Canada, NZ, the United Kingdom (UK) or the United States of America (USA);andhas a background history that is verifiable and can be assessed as appropriate by the NZ Security Intelligence Service (NZSIS) towards a recommendation of suitability for a security clearance at this level.
If you do not meet these minimum criteria, we will not be able to accept your application.
